Lines Matching defs:shost

169 bfad_im_info(struct Scsi_Host *shost)
173 (struct bfad_im_port_s *) shost->hostdata[0];
192 struct Scsi_Host *shost = cmnd->device->host;
194 (struct bfad_im_port_s *) shost->hostdata[0];
216 im_port->shost->host_no, cmnd, hal_io->iotag);
233 im_port->shost->host_no, cmnd, hal_io->iotag);
293 struct Scsi_Host *shost = cmnd->device->host;
295 (struct bfad_im_port_s *) shost->hostdata[0];
370 struct Scsi_Host *shost = cmnd->device->host;
373 (struct bfad_im_port_s *) shost->hostdata[0];
475 port->im_port->shost->host_no,
551 im_port->shost = bfad_scsi_host_alloc(im_port, bfad);
552 if (!im_port->shost) {
557 im_portp = shost_priv(im_port->shost);
559 im_port->shost->unique_id = im_port->idr_id;
560 im_port->shost->this_id = -1;
561 im_port->shost->max_id = MAX_FCP_TARGET;
562 im_port->shost->max_lun = MAX_FCP_LUN;
563 im_port->shost->max_cmd_len = 16;
564 im_port->shost->can_queue = bfad->cfg_data.ioc_queue_depth;
566 im_port->shost->transportt = bfad_im_scsi_transport_template;
568 im_port->shost->transportt =
571 error = scsi_add_host_with_dma(im_port->shost, dev, &bfad->pcidev->dev);
580 scsi_host_put(im_port->shost);
581 im_port->shost = NULL;
595 im_port->shost->host_no);
597 fc_remove_host(im_port->shost);
599 scsi_remove_host(im_port->shost);
600 scsi_host_put(im_port->shost);
677 struct Scsi_Host *shost = bfad->pport.im_port->shost;
686 fc_host_post_vendor_event(shost, fc_get_event_number(),
1027 struct Scsi_Host *host = im_port->shost;
1073 fc_remote_port_add(im_port->shost, 0, &rport_ids);
1135 im_port->shost->host_no,
1168 im_port->shost->host_no,